Overview - ISO 389-8:2004 (Acoustics, RETSPL for circumaural earphones)
ISO 389-8:2004 specifies reference equivalent threshold sound pressure levels (RETSPLs) for pure tones from 125 Hz to 8 kHz for use in the calibration of air-conduction audiometers fitted with a specific circumaural earphone model - the SENNHEISER HDA 200. The standard provides the reference values (Table 1), notes on derivation (Annex A), measured sound attenuation of the HDA 200 (Annex B) and correction figures to obtain free-field equivalent outputs for speech audiometers (Annex C). Values are derived from multi-laboratory studies and are intended to standardize audiometric calibration and reporting.
Key topics and technical requirements
- Scope: RETSPLs for pure tones 125 Hz–8 kHz specifically for the HDA 200 circumaural earphone.
- Calibration setup: Use the ear simulator and adapter specified in IEC 60318-1 and IEC 60318-2 as indicated in the standard.
- Reference values: Table 1 gives RETSPLs (values rounded to 0.5 dB). Example values from the standard: 125 Hz ≈ 30.5 dB, 1 kHz ≈ 5.5 dB. Some frequencies are interpolated.
- Environmental and mechanical conditions: Calibrate near 21 °C to 25 °C; maintain headband force of 10.0 N ± 1.0 N with earphone placement dimensions as specified.
- Annex B (attenuation): Provides measured sound attenuation of HDA 200 across octave bands (example: 1 kHz ≈ 28.5 dB).
- Annex C (free-field corrections): Correction figures to convert coupler measurements to free-field equivalent levels - useful for speech audiometry (IEC 60645-2 types A–E and B–E).
Applications and who uses ISO 389-8
- Audiology clinics and hearing-care professionals: ensures consistent audiometer calibration for reliable pure-tone threshold testing.
- Calibration laboratories and metrology institutes: use RETSPLs and prescribed coupler/adapter setup to verify and certify audiometric equipment.
- Manufacturers of audiometers and earphones: validate design and provide conformity data for device calibration.
- Occupational health and hearing conservation programs: maintain standardized test conditions and measurement traceability.
Practical value: follow the standard to reduce inter-laboratory variability, ensure accurate threshold measurements, and apply Annex C corrections when converting to free-field speech levels.
